Grilo means cricket or grasshopper in Portuguese. It is the name given to me by my family in Brasil. It seemed all too fitting when I began my apprenticeships. "You have much to learn grasshopper."
I began working with metal in auto body class in the former auto department at Santa Monica College. From the first moment that the flame began to melt the steel, I fell in love with metalwork. From there, luck and I guess, my personality, led me to the custom knife, jewelry and motorcycle worlds. I have been lucky enough to meet and be taught by some of the most knowlegeable and skilled people in their industry. My time with Master Smith, Scott Taylor(RIP), was where I became dedicated to the art. Unfortunately, Scott died before our time together was done. With so much more to learn and experience, his widow and friends have taken over and have helped me continue my training. In the motorcycle industry, Master Builder and buisness man, Gard Hollinger of LA County Choprods, set me under his wing and lets me work and learn out of his shop. Soon enough, I had realized that I am not a knife maker, not a jeweler, not a custom bike builder, but a general metalsmith. I have never been able or willing to focus my efforts on one aspect of metal working and all my teachers laugh and shake their heads at me. This will either be my demise, or my success. Time will tell... In the mean time, I'm having a blast!
